How to Make Extra Lemony Seitan Piccata
Ingredients:
- 1 pound seitan, sliced
- 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
- 4 tablespoons olive oil
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up vegetable broth
- Juice of 2 lemons
- 1/4 cup capers, rinsed
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
Directions:
Step 1: Preparation
Dredge the sliced seitan in flour mixed with salt and pepper. This adds a subtle crunch and flavor that will enhance the dish.
Step 2: Cooking the Seitan
In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Once hot, add the seitan and cook until golden brown on both sides, which should take about 5-7 minutes in total.
Step 3: Sautéing the Garlic
Remove the seitan from the skillet and set aside. In the same skillet, add the minced garlic, sautéing it until fragrant—this will take about 1 minute.
Step 4: Finishing the Dish
Pour in the vegetable broth and lemon juice, bringing the mixture to a simmer. Stir in the capers and return the seitan to the skillet. Cook for an additional 5 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together beautifully. Finally, garnish with fresh parsley before serving.
How to Serve Extra Lemony Seitan Piccata
Serve this dish over a bed of fluffy rice, quinoa, or alongside steamed vegetables for a balanced meal. It’s excellent with a side of crusty bread, allowing you to soak up the delicious garlic-lemon sauce.
How to Store Extra Lemony Seitan Piccata
If you have leftovers, they can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ave until heated through. The flavors may deepen after a day in the fridge, making the leftovers even tastier!
Expert Tips for Perfect Extra Lemony Seitan Piccata
- Adjusting Flavor: Feel free to adjust the amount of lemon juice and capers to suit your taste. For a milder flavor, you can reduce the lemon juice slightly.
- Gluten-Free Option: If you need a gluten-free option, try using chickpea flour instead of all-purpose flour for dredging the seitan.
- Adding Vegetables: Throw in some spinach or artichokes while simmering for added nutrition and flavor.

Frequently Asked Questions
-
Can I use tofu instead of seitan?
Yes, tofu can be used as a substitute, but you’ll want to press it to remove excess moisture and cube it for cooking. -
Is seitan healthy?
Seitan is a good source of plant-based protein; however, it’s high in sodium. Pair it with plenty of vegetables for a nutritious meal. -
Can I freeze the leftovers?
Yes, you can freeze the cooked dish for up to 2 months. Defrost in the fridge before reheating. -
What can I serve with this dish?
Consider serving it with pasta, rice, or a light salad to complement the flavors. -
Can I make this dish 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the seitan and sauce in advance and reheat them when ready to serve.
